MCPX is a production-ready, open-source gateway to manage MCP servers at scale—centralize tool discovery, access controls, call prioritization, and usage tracking to simplify agent workflows.
Lunar.dev is an open-source platform for managing, governing and optimizing third-party API consumption across applications and AI agent workloads at scale.
As AI agents and autonomous workflows increasingly rely on external APIs, there's a growing need for a mediation layer that acts as a central aggregation point between applications, agents, and the services they depend on.
Lunar.dev provides that layer—serving as a unified API Gateway for AI, delivering:
